Pemberley House delivers compassionate, 24/7 care to all residents. Compassion is paramount within their Basingstoke care homes.

Couples or companions looking to continue their care journey together are also welcomed at their home, which offers residential, respite, dementia, and nursing care.

Residents often praise the supportive and friendly atmosphere that Pemberley House extends to all occupants and visitors.

Encouraging residents to personalise their bedrooms fosters a homely atmosphere. All bedrooms are equipped with en-suite wet rooms, a TV, and telephone points. Each floor of the Basingstoke care home has its own intimate lounge and dining room. The ground floor café is a popular spot for those who enjoy coffee meet-ups and slices of cake. Additionally, the home boasts its own hair salon.

Support you may be entitled to

If you chose a care home based in England, you may be eligible for NHS Funded Nursing Care (FNC), which helps cover the cost of nursing. This is worth £254.06 per week and is usually paid directly to the care home.

We were very apprehensive as to how the move from another care home would affect mum. We need not have been concerned as, because of the excellent care and attention she has received, she has quickly settled and accepted her new home. She is relaxed and much happier than she has been in a long time.
She loves joining in with all the activities and is pleased to have made new friends. We now feel that mum's needs are being met and her quality of life has improved. It has been great to share so many laughs with mum since she has moved to Pemberley.

Life at Pemberley is very comfortable - good personal care and nursing requirements are met. The food is excellent, with a good variety of menus but I would prefer the supper time to be a bit later. I have noticed a change lately in the atmosphere and attitude of the staff, and it all seems much friendlier.


There are now more activities and I join in those which particularly appeal to me. My accommodation is excellent, especially the wet room and I am very comfortable there. I have recently purchased an electric wheelchair, which fits perfectly into my room, and has given me back a great deal of independence.

The main problem is that there are too few regular carers. Even if there are four on duty there are at least three residents that need assistance from two or three carers. When this happens those needing toileting or a drink just have to wait until someone becomes available. There is usually a relative
willing to make tea etc. This is not a criticism of the carers, most of whom are exceptional. The residents are rarely taken out in the minibus. My husband has been out only four times in the two years he's been there. All staff friendly and welcoming.

The maximum Review Score for a Care Home is 10, which is made up from the Average Rating of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) and the Number of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) in the last 24 months:

  1. 5 Points are available for the Average Rating from all Reviews in the last 24 months. The Average Rating of 4.872 for Pemberley House Care Home - Avery Healthcare is calculated as follows: ( (219 Excellents x 5) + (30 Goods x 4) + (1 Satisfactorys x 3) ) ÷ 250 Ratings = 4.872
  2. 5 Points are available for the number of Positive Reviews in the last 24 months. A Positive Review is defined as any Review with an 'Overall Experience' of '4' or '5' (out of a max rating '5'). The 5 Points relating to the number of positive Reviews for Pemberley House Care Home - Avery Healthcare is based on 21 positive Reviews in the last 24 months and is calculated as per below:

    The 5 points available are broken down as follows:

    1. 4 points are available for the first 10 Positive Reviews in the last 24 months; 3 points for the first Positive Review, and then 0.125 Points for each of the next four Positive Reviews and then 0.1 Points for the next five Positive Reviews. (1st = 3.000, 2nd = 0.125, 3rd = 0.125, 4th = 0.125, 5th = 0.125, 6th = 0.100, 7th = 0.100, 8th = 0.100, 9th = 0.100, 10th = 0.100) 3 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 = 4
    2. 1 point is available for the number of Positive Reviews reaching 20% of the registered maximum number of service users in the last 24 months. If this number is partially reached, then that proportion of 1 point is given. eg a Care Home registered for a maximum of 50 service users has to reach 10 Positive Reviews to receive 1 point, if it has 7 reviews it will receive 0.7 points. 20% of the 72 registered maximum number of service users is 14.4, which has been reached with 21 Positive reviews. Points = 1
  3. When a Review is submitted by someone who has previously submitted a Review, only the latest Review will count towards the Review Score.
  4. If a Care Home does not have a review in the last 24 months, then it will not have a Review Score.
